#e67052 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e67052 is composed of 90.2% red, 43.9%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.3% magenta, 64.3%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 12.2 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 61.2%. #e67052 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e0a4 with #cd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#e67052 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e67052 has RGB values of R:230, G:112,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.64,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15102034.

Shades and Tints of #e67052
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100502 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#e67052
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a19997 is the less saturated color, while #fd623b is the most saturated one.
